C-160D Transall

Großbaustelle Fliegerhorst Wunstorf. Die Transall C-160D ist ein in deutsch-französischer Kooperation entwickeltes und gebautes taktisches Transportflugzeug mittlerer Größe. Aufgrund der Bauweise ist die Transall ausgezeichnet für den Einsatz auf Behelfsflugplätzen, wie zum Beispiel in Afrika üblich, geeignet. Wunstorf ist seit 1978 Heimat des Lufttransportgeschwaders 62. Das Lufttransportgeschader 62 ist der komplexeste fliegende Verband der Luftwaffe. Dem Geschwader sind drei fliegende Staffeln unterstellt, wovon zwei mit der C-160 Transall ausgestattet sind. Die 1. Fliegende Staffel nutzt die C-160 Transall zur Durchführung von weltweiten Lufttransportaufträgen von der Heimatbasis in Wunstorf. Die 3. Fliegende Staffel stellt die Ausbildung der Transall-Besatzungen sicher. Die 4. Fliegende Staffel ist in Bremen stationiert und führt in Zusammenarbeit mit der Lufthansa Flight Training GmbH die fliegerische Grundlagenausbildung der Transportflieger der Bundeswehr .

AV-8B Harrier

An AV-8B Harrier performs a vertical landing aboard the amphibious assault ship USS Kearsarge (LHD 3) during Bold Alligator 2012. Bold Alligator is the largest amphibious exercise in the past 10 years and represents the Navy and Marine Corps' revitalization of the full range of amphibious operations. The exercise focuses on today's fight with today's forces, while showcasing the advantages of seabasing. The exercise will take place Jan. 30 through Feb. 12, 2012 afloat and ashore in and around Virginia and North Carolina. #BA12 (U.S. Navy photo by Mass Communication Specialist 2nd Class Tom Gagnier/Released)
